Mattress Suitability Considerations
Which factors should be examined to guarantee mattress compatibility with adjustable lift beds? Initially, the mattress model plays a major role; memory foam and latex mattresses often function properly, whereas innerspring mattresses may not respond well to the bed's movements. Additionally, mattress thickness should be considered; a height ranging from 10 to 14 inches is recommended for optimal operation. Weight distribution is an additional aspect; heavier mattresses might obstruct adjustments. Furthermore, the mattress's flexibility is essential; those that are flexible can better support the bed's positioning. Lastly, reviewing the manufacturer's guidelines for compatibility supports peak performance and durability of both mattress and adjustable lift bed. These points contribute to a harmonious sleeping environment.
Categories of Control Mechanism Varieties
Considering mattress compatibility is simply the initial step; the types of control mechanisms for adjustable lift beds likewise play a large role in user experience. There are primarily two types of control mechanisms: wired and wireless. Wired control devices offer trustworthiness and ease of use via a straightforward interface. However, movement can be limited because of cord restrictions. In contrast, wireless controls provide versatility and convenience, allowing users to adjust settings from anywhere in the room. Some designs incorporate smartphone integration to boost accessibility. Moreover, users ought to consider presets and customizable settings that can significantly enhance comfort and usability. Ultimately, picking the correct control mechanism is vital for getting the most out of an adjustable lift bed, customized to individual preferences and requirements.
Choosing the Best Adjustable Bed for Your Way of Life
How can one manage the varied options available when selecting an adjustable bed? The process starts by looking at individual needs and preferences. Elements such as sleep position, health conditions, and lifestyle should guide the decision. For those with back issues, models that offer lumbar support may be critical, while side sleepers might prioritize beds with customizable upper body elevation.
Additionally, size and fit with current bedding must be considered. A queen or king-sized adjustable bed could provide ample space for couples, while a twin may suit single users.
Features such as zero-gravity settings, massage options, and remote controls can enhance comfort and convenience, but they should correspond to individual preferences instead of being regarded as necessities.
Ultimately, in-depth research combined with sampling various models in-store helps users locate the adjustable bed that optimally matches their lifestyle, ensuring a comfortable and restorative sleep experience.

Will Customizable Beds Work with Standard Bed Frames and Mattresses?
Adjustable sleep systems usually fit standard bed frames, but compatibility may differ by model. Most adjustable bases accommodate standard mattress sizes, providing seamless integration. It’s suggested to double-check specific measurements before purchase to ascertain proper compatibility.
Do Adjustable Beds Aid in Snoring Problems?
Adjustable beds work to relieve snoring difficulties by elevating the upper body, thereby opening airways and diminishing obstructive sleep apnea. Many users report improved breathing and a more restful sleep environment with this adjustable positioning.

How do flexible beds impact sleep apnea?
Adjustable beds can positively influence sleep apnea by allowing users to lift their upper body. This position may reduce airway obstruction, supporting better breathing during sleep and possibly lowering the frequency of apnea episodes.
What defines the maintenance and care specifications for variable beds?
Adjustable beds need regular checks for mechanical functionality, ensuring all moving parts are lubricated and free of debris. Mattress cleaning and inspection for wear needs to be done periodically to maintain peak performance and hygiene.
